Ukraine’s Parliament Passes Bill Allowing Some Convicts to Serve within the Army


Ukraine’s Parliament handed a invoice on Wednesday that can permit some convicts to serve within the navy in trade for the potential for parole on the finish of their service, a transfer aimed toward replenishing the military’s depleted ranks after greater than two years of warfare.

The invoice should nonetheless be signed into legislation by President Volodymyr Zelensky. It was not instantly clear if he would accomplish that, given the sensitivity of the matter.

The coverage echoes a apply utilized by Russia, which has dedicated tens of hundreds of convicts to the warfare, permitting it to achieve the higher hand in bloody assaults by sheer pressure of numbers. While Russia has enlisted all method of prisoners, the Ukrainian invoice says that these convicted of premeditated homicide, rape or different severe offenses is not going to be eligible — though some lawmakers mentioned involuntary manslaughter convictions might be thought of.

Olena Shulyak, the chief of President Volodymyr Zelensky’s Servant of the People party, mentioned that the choice to mobilize and parole a prisoner can be made by a court docket and would require the prisoner’s willingness to hitch the military.

“The solely strategy to survive in an all-out warfare towards an enemy with extra sources is to consolidate all forces,” Ms. Shulyak wrote in a put up on social media. “This draft legislation is about our wrestle and preservation of Ukrainian statehood.”

Prisoners serving within the military can be built-in into particular models at some stage in martial legislation, that means that they might not be demobilized till the tip of the warfare. Ms. Shulyak additionally advised a Ukrainian information outlet that solely prisoners with underneath three years left on their sentences can be eligible.

The invoice is the newest in a string of current efforts — together with a invoice signed into legislation final month that lowered the draft eligibility age to 25 from 27 — by Ukraine’s authorities to bolster its exhausted and diminished troops.

Mr. Zelensky mentioned in February that 31,000 Ukrainian troopers had been killed since Russia’s full-scale invasion started greater than two years in the past. The determine is effectively beneath estimates by U.S. officers, who final summer time mentioned that almost 70,000 Ukrainians had been killed.

As the warfare drags on, Ukraine is struggling to recruit or draft extra folks into its military. Critics say the official mobilization system has been mired in Soviet-style forms and corruption, and instances of draft dodging have multiplied in current months. Gen. Yurii Sodol, the commander of forces within the east, advised Parliament final month that in sure sections of the entrance, Russians outnumber Ukrainians by greater than seven to at least one.

The invoice that handed on Wednesday was designed to assist clear up the troop shortages, in line with a number of lawmakers. David Arakhamia, the pinnacle of Mr. Zelensky’s party in Parliament, mentioned that it might consequence within the mobilization of between 15,000 and 20,000 prisoners, in line with Ukrainian information shops.

Lawmakers overwhelmingly voted in favor: 279 voted to move it, with 11 abstaining and none voting towards it.

“We want folks in trenches,” Oleksiy Honcharenko, a member of Parliament within the opposition European Solidarity party, mentioned in a cellphone interview after the vote. “Why ought to businessmen and artists combat and never thieves and petty criminals?”

Both the Soviet Union and Germany additionally drafted prisoners throughout World War II, in line with Thibault Fouillet, the deputy director of the Institute for Strategic and Defense Studies, a French analysis heart.

“This is a standard wartime apply, each in main wars and in civil or revolutionary wars,” Mr. Fouillet mentioned. “However, these are sometimes short-term measures and operations undertaken when there’s a scarcity of manpower.”

But the choice to let prisoners serve within the Ukrainian Army might show controversial. And Mr. Zelensky — who prior to now has for months delayed signing delicate payments, such because the one reducing the draft age — could be reluctant to endorse it, mentioned Oleksandr Musiienko, the pinnacle of the Kyiv-based Center for Military Legal Studies.

“There continues to be vital dialogue available earlier than the invoice is signed into legislation,” Mr. Musiienko mentioned.
